Sorry for the slow response, I have 39.5 X 13.5 R 16 super swamper Irok tires. With the 16 inch rims that are only 8 inches wide, and only 15 psi in the tires they measure 38.5 inches tall.
I have a Tj, that is roughly 5,000 pounds the way I measured it. Fully loaded with tools, spare parts, and spare tire. Also has one ton axles.
